Fat Dog Mylo

So this blog has not been touched in awhile.. seems like its gone to the sidelines. 
And since Kiefer has been born seems like Mylo has too.

We used to go to the dog park or swimming all the time. Plus walks did not feel like a chore before we had a baby but now its tough trying to do things with a "not well behaved" dog and baby in tow. 

Today we had an eye opener. Mylo went for his vaccines and checkup. He's now 79lbs. He's gained about 8 lbs since last checkup. Not horrible but the Vet would like to see him back down around 70 or 72ish. 

Mylo does still get walked 2x a day - thats more than a lot of dogs but he has been getting more table scraps...
Kiefer droppings (cracker crumbs or rice puffs), plus I did give him leftover rice last night. And we can't forget that whole chicken breast he ate - bones and all! 
Do you think that might be adding to the weight situation??

So here is our plan:

NO people food at all!! 
That means I have to watch Kiefer's food droppings, and stop forgetting food on the counter -Yes Mylo eats whats left out. (Bad dog) 

Also watch the treats we are giving him. We haven't been giving him too many lately. I realized that the other day. We used to give him treats for everything. (Sitting, staying, and any other trick he can do)

Last but not least; More exercise. I need to go for longer walks, or play with Mylo in the backyard or find a way to take Mylo to the park.

I really don't like FAT LABS... and I don't want Mylo to turn into one.
